Subject: Cut-over summary — Larkspool parcel-tracking webhook

Hi,

As requested for your review, here is the summary of yesterday's cut-over. We moved the Larkspool parcel-tracking webhook from the legacy dispatcher to the new Quillgate relay at 06:00. Delivery retries, signature verification, and replay protection all behaved as expected during the two-hour observation window, and no events were dropped. The old endpoint is now disabled. The relay now runs with the following configuration values.

deployment values, kajef-fahip:
druwyn:
  pin: 0722
  metrics_host: metrics.druwyn.zemvarsys.internal
  tenant: juldor
  seal: seal_6ddf1794

Alert: TileCrate cache hit rate below 60% for 15 minutes.

Welcome aboard — this one fires more often than it should. TileCrate sits in front of the map renderer, and a low hit rate usually means someone pushed a new style bundle, invalidating every tile at once. Renders get slow but nothing's broken; the cache rewarms in about an hour. If it doesn't recover, check the eviction metrics for a misconfigured TTL. The warm-up procedure and dashboards are on the internal page below.

wiki page, tahaf-tajog: https://jira.ordindyn.corp/pipeline

TURN-208: Gatevale turnstile counters at the Merrow Field pilot double-count when a rotation reverses mid-cycle. Attendance totals drift roughly 2% high per event. The debounce window fix is implemented, reviewed by Ilsa, and soak-tested across two simulated match days without drift. Ready for your cut; the candidate build is identified below.

trace token, tagag-tafog: htk6_5ed18c

Subject: Handover — string extraction release duties

Hi team, handing over the LinguaSift extraction script while I'm out. It runs nightly against the Brackenford app repos, pulls new translatable strings, and opens a merge request with the updated catalogs. Please review the diff carefully — malformed placeholders have slipped through before and broken the French build. If the nightly run fails, rerun manually with the verbose flag and check the catalog lint output. When you publish the updated catalogs, sign the bundle with this key:

rollout seal: bky4_x7Gc